OSC grosses me into submission.

I’ve put away Hart’s Hope, even though I’d nearly reached the end. Honestly, it was just way too stinking gory for me. The story was interesting, the world well-developed, the writing excellent, but I know it gave me nightmares and after a certain point I just couldn’t bear to pick it up anymore. It’s unfortunate that it was my first Card, because I’m told not everything he’s written is quite so graphic.

Instead I’m reading Alanna by Tamora Pierce now, and while the writing is definitely simpler than what I’m used to, I’m hoping it’ll be a quick but fun read. Considering I have yet to add a single book to my 50bookchallenge tally!

If you’re looking for something to read.

The Preliminary Nebula Awards Ballot has been released. Fantasy/SF awards lists are great places to find interesting books you’ve missed out on in the previous year. If you want to go back farther than the previous year, I recommend the list of past Mythopoeic Award winners and past Mythopoeic Fantasy Award finalists.
